| Test Item | Common Testing Method | Method Overview |
|---|---|---|
| Purity Determination | High-Performance Liquid Chromatography (HPLC) | A reverse-phase C18 chromatographic column is used with a phosphate buffer-organic solvent mobile phase. Quantitative analysis of the main component purity is performed using a UV detector (e.g., at 254 nm). This method is sensitive and accurate, suitable for raw material quality control. |
| Related Substances (Impurities) | HPLC with Gradient Elution | Main peak and potential impurity peaks are separated using a gradient elution program. The content of each impurity is calculated based on relative retention time and peak area, in accordance with ICH Q3A guideline requirements. |
| Loss on Drying | Oven Drying Method (or Thermogravimetric Analysis, TGA) | The sample is dried at a specified temperature (e.g., 105°C) until constant weight is achieved, and the percentage of mass loss is calculated to evaluate moisture and volatile substance content. |
| Residue on Ignition | High-Temperature Ashing Method | The sample is incinerated at high temperature (700–800°C), and the mass of the residual inorganic matter is measured to control inorganic impurities or catalyst residues. |
| Heavy Metals | Heavy Metal Test Method from the Chinese Pharmacopoeia | The thiocyanate method or ICP-MS is used to perform colorimetric comparison under acidic conditions or directly measure total levels of lead, cadmium, mercury, arsenic, etc., ensuring compliance with limit standards. |
| Residual Solvents | Headspace Gas Chromatography (HS-GC) | Head-space sampling technology is employed to separate and detect residual organic solvents (e.g., methanol, ethanol, DMF) by gas chromatography with FID or MS detection, in line with ICH Q3C requirements. |
| Structural Confirmation | Infrared Spectroscopy (IR), Nuclear Magnetic Resonance (NMR) | IR is used for functional group identification; ¹H/¹³C NMR provides information about hydrogen and carbon environments, while mass spectrometry (MS) confirms molecular weight. These methods collectively verify compound structural consistency. |
| pH Value | pH Meter Method | A solution of specific concentration (e.g., 1% w/v) is prepared, and pH is directly measured using a calibrated pH meter to reflect acidity/basicity and possible acidic/basic impurities. |
| Melting Point | Capillary Melting Point Method | A digital melting point apparatus is used to determine the temperature range from initial melting to complete melting as a physical constant indicator, assisting in assessing substance purity and crystal form consistency. |
| Appearance and Color | Visual Color Comparison Method | The color of the solid (should be white to off-white powder) is observed against a white background. If necessary, it is compared with standard color solutions to control colored impurities. |
| Test Item | Specification |
|---|---|
| Appearance | White to almost white crystalline powder |
| Purity | >=98.5% (HPLC) |
| Melting Point | 265-270 °C |
| Water Content (KF) | <=0.5% |
| Total Impurities | <=1.5% |
| Single Impurity | <=0.5% |
| Heavy Metals | <=10 ppm |
| Residue on Ignition | <=0.1% |
| Acid Value (mg KOH/g) | 480-500 mg KOH/g |
